Property Details for 45 Henry St, Stepney

45 Henry St, Stepney is a 5 bedroom, 1 bathroom House and was built in 1926. The property has a land size of 847m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in November 2020.

Last Listing description (June 2017)

Not for the faint-hearted, but an exciting commercial or residential proposition for those in the know. Saddling up against the elite eastern suburbs of St. Peters, College Park and Norwood on some 847sqm of land, with easy access from Nelson Street, Payneham and Magill Roads, lots of sweat and oodles of inspiration will certainly bring the shine back to this Stepney C.1920's character bungalow.
From a good going over, you'll catch glimpses of its former glory - lead light windows, decorative ceilings, character fireplaces and timber boards, but you'll need a little more than a magic wand to transform this treasure.
In which case, the sprawling landholding (a rare find in these parts) gives rise to knock-over-start-over consideration, subdivision potential for more commercial or light industrial enterprises, or perhaps a combined office below/residence above scenario (subject to the usual council consents.)

What you do with the existing property and it's fading outbuildings is completely up to you, but in its current arrangement you'll discover a two-storey home comprising five bedrooms, living room, dining room, rear kitchen/meals and bathroom with an exterior laundry and toilet.
Upstairs, you'll find storage cavities and two of the five bedrooms. Beyond the residence (and in a state of some disrepair) is a pool, a series of joined sheds and a workshop/garage with a pit.

About Stepney 5069

The size of Stepney is approximately 0.5 square kilometres. It has 2 parks covering nearly 4.1% of total area. The population of Stepney in 2011 was 855 people. By 2016 the population was 859 showing a population growth of 0.5%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Stepney is 20-29 years. Households in Stepney are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Stepney work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 64.3% of the homes in Stepney were owner-occupied compared with 59.5% in 2016.

Stepney has 785 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Stepney have seen a 71.02%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 88.38% increase. As at 31 August 2024:

  • The median value for Houses in Stepney is $1,404,922 while the median value for Units is $716,896.
  • Houses have a median rent of $680 while Units have a median rent of $473.
